Test-Drive the US 98 / CR 491 Roundabout Before it is Built

Roundabout Test Track

Understanding that some drivers may have never driven through a roundabout, the Florida Department 
of Transportation, District Seven, is offering area residents the opportunity to drive their own 
vehicles through a test track, set up to the dimensions of the roundabout that will begin 
construction in November at the intersection of US 98 and CR 491 (Citrus Way). Drivers 
participating in the test-drive sessions will be able to get a feel for how the roundabout will 
function, without the distraction of traffic. Staff will be available to answer questions and 
distribute informational materials.

A full-scale version of the future US 98 / CR 491 highway roundabout has been set up in Citrus 
County. This roundabout test track will be available for any interested drivers to use between 9:30 
a.m. and noon on Wednesday, October 13 and between 4 p.m. and 6 p.m. on Thursday, October 14.
